In the Czech automotive market, several specific factors can influence how a registration-based valuation is interpreted. For instance, the presence of a valid technical inspection (STK) and the history of emissions tests are vital components that buyers look for. Additionally, the history of ownership, whether the car was used as a company vehicle or a private one, can impact its perceived value. Digital tools often incorporate these historical markers to refine their estimates, ensuring that the user receives a comprehensive view of how their vehicle compares to others currently available on the market.

Understanding the costs associated with obtaining these valuations is essential for any car owner. While many platforms provide a basic estimate for free, more comprehensive reports that include accident history or detailed odometer verification often require a small fee. These paid services are particularly valuable when preparing a vehicle for sale, as they provide third-party verification that can justify a higher asking price. Below is a comparison of common services available to vehicle owners looking to assess their car’s market position.


Product/Service Name Provider Key Features Cost Estimation
Basic Market Valuation Sauto.cz Real-time market comparison Free
Vehicle History Report Cebia Odometer and accident check 499 CZK - 599 CZK
Comprehensive History CarVertical International database search 400 CZK - 700 CZK
Professional Appraisal Dekra Physical inspection and certification 2,000 CZK - 4,500 CZK
Trade-in Valuation Auto ESA Immediate purchase offer Free
